Contact the supplierMay 17, 2020·Hand hygiene is an important part of the U.S. response to the international emergence of COVID-19. Practicing hand hygiene, which includes the use of alcohol-based hand rub (ABHR) or handwashing, is a simple yet effective way to prevent the spread of pathogens and infections in healthcare settings. CDC recommendations reflect this important role.

Contact the supplierAug 07, 2020·Updated August 7, 2020. After the U.S. Food & Drug Administration (FDA) flagged five brands of potentially dangerous hand sanitizers in June, the list of products that may be contaminated with methanol has skyrocketed to about 60 brands, which makes 135 varieties of sanitizer.
